详细讲解计算机BIOS系统设置

整理文档很辛苦,赏杯茶钱您下走!

免费阅读已结束,点击下载阅读编辑剩下 ...

阅读已结束,您可以下载文档离线阅读编辑

资源描述

江西工业工程职业技术学院丁强华2019年7月30日星期二10时44分45秒1第三章计算机BIOS系统设置第一节计算机正常启动过程第二节BIOS系统第三节AWARDBIOS设置第四节BIOS—ID第五节BIOS升级江西工业工程职业技术学院丁强华2019年7月30日星期二10时44分45秒2第一节计算机正常启动过程BIOS(BasicInput/OutputSystem)即基本输入/输出系统。它为计算机提供最低级、最直接的硬件控制,计算机的原始操作都是按此程序完成的,它是硬件与软件之间的接口。3.1计算机正常启动过程3.1.1执行跳转指令按下电源开关,主板开关电路动作,使电源开始向主板和其他设备供电。主板上的控制芯片组向CPU发出RESET信号,让CPU内部自动恢复到初始状态,但CPU并不工作。当芯片组检测到电源已经稳定供电后(即PowerGood信号电压已升为+5V),便撤去RESET信号(如果手工按下RESET按钮,那么松开时,就相当于撤去RESET信号,计算机才重启),CPU就从地址FFFF0H处开始执行一条跳转指令,转到系统BIOS中真正的启动代码处。3.1.2进入POST自检系统BIOS启动代码首先执行POST(PowerOnSelfTest,加电自检)。POST的主要任务是检测系统中的一些关键设备是否存在和能否正常工作。由于POST是最早进行的检测过程,此时显卡还没有初始化,如果系统BIOS在进行POST的过程中发现一些致命错误,如没有找到内存或内存有问题(此时只会检查640K常规内存),会直接控制喇叭发声来报告错误,声音的长短和次数代表了错误的类型。江西工业工程职业技术学院丁强华2019年7月30日星期二10时44分45秒3第一节计算机正常启动过程3.1.3初始化显卡接下来系统BIOS查找显卡BIOS,存放显卡BIOS的ROM芯片的起始地址通常在C0000H处,找到显卡BIOS之后就调用它的初始化代码,由显卡BIOS来初始化显卡,此时会在屏幕上显示出一些初始化信息,有生产厂商、图形芯片类型、显存大小等内容(如图3-1),不过这个画面几乎一闪而过。3.1.4显示BIOS画面查找完所有其他设备的BIOS之后,系统BIOS将显示自己的画面如图3-2所示,其中包括系统BIOS类型、序列号和版本号等内容。同时屏幕底端左下角会出现主板信息代码,即BIOS-ID。江西工业工程职业技术学院丁强华2019年7月30日星期二10时44分45秒4第一节计算机正常启动过程3.1.5测试CPU和内存接着系统BIOS将检测和显示CPU类型和工作频率,然后开始测试RAM,同时在屏幕上显示内存测试的进度。3.1.6检测标准设备然后系统BIOS将开始检测系统中安装的一些标准硬件设备,包括硬盘、CD-ROM、软驱、串口、并口等设备,另外较新版本的BIOS在这一过程中还会自动检测和设置内存的定时参数、硬盘参数和访问模式等。3.1.7检测即插即用设备接下来系统BIOS内部支持即插即用的代码将开始检测和配置系统中安装的即插即用设备,每找到一个设备之后,系统BIOS为该设备分配中断、DMA通道和I/0端口等资源。有错时也会显示相应的提示。江西工业工程职业技术学院丁强华2019年7月30日星期二10时44分45秒5第一节计算机正常启动过程3.1.8显示配置表到这一步为止,所有硬件都已经检测配置完毕了,系统BIOS会重新清屏并在屏幕上方显示出一个表格,其中概略地列出了系统中安装的各种标准硬件设备,以及它们使用的资源和一些相关工作参数如图3-3。江西工业工程职业技术学院丁强华2019年7月30日星期二10时44分45秒6第一节计算机正常启动过程3.1.9更新ESCD接下来系统BIOS将更新ESCD(ExtendedSystemConfigurationData,扩展系统配置数据)。ESCD是系统BIOS用来与操作系统交换硬件配置信息的一种数据,这些数据被存放在CMOS之中。通常ESCD数据只在系统硬件配置发生改变后才会更新,因此不是每次启动机器都能够看到“UpdateESCD……Success”这样的信息。然后显示检测到的多媒体设备的信息,如中断号、请求号等。3.1.10按指定的顺序启动磁盘ESCD更新完毕后,系统BIOS的启动代码将根据用户指定的启动顺序从软盘、硬盘或光驱启动。以从C盘启动为例,系统BIOS将读取并执行硬盘上的主引导记录,主引导记录接着从分区表中找到第一个活动分区,然后读取并执行这个活动分区的分区引导记录,而分区引导记录将负责读取并执行IO.SYS、CONFIG.SYS、MSDOS.SYS、COMMAND.COM,最后执行AUTOEXEC.BAT,出现提示符,将使用权交给用户。对于Windows将继续进行GUI(图形用户界面)部分的引导和初始化工作。热启动或从Windows中选择重新启动计算机,那么POST过程将被跳过,直接从第三步开始,另外第五步的检测CPU和内存也不会再进行。江西工业工程职业技术学院丁强华2019年7月30日星期二10时44分45秒7第一节计算机正常启动过程江西工业工程职业技术学院丁强华2019年7月30日星期二10时44分45秒8第一节计算机正常启动过程江西工业工程职业技术学院丁强华2019年7月30日星期二10时44分45秒9第二节BIOS系统3.2.1什么叫BIOSBIOS用来管理计算机所有的输入与输出,为计算机提供最低级的、最直接的硬件控制与支持。在BIOSROM芯片中装有一个程序为“系统设置程序”,用来设置CMOSRAM中的参数。这个设置CMOS参数的过程,习惯上称为“BIOS设置”或“CMOS设置”。3.2.2BIOS的功能1.自检及初始化功能这部分负责启动计算机,具体有三个部分。1)自检用于计算机刚接通电源时对硬件的检测,功能是检查计算机是否良好。2)初始化包括创建中断向量、设置寄存器,对一些外部设备进行初始化和检测等,其中很重要的一部分是BIOS设置,主要是对硬件设置一些参数,当计算机启动时会读取这些参数,并和实际硬件设置进行比较,如果不符合,会影响系统的启动。江西工业工程职业技术学院丁强华2019年7月30日星期二10时44分45秒10第二节BIOS系统3)引导程序功能是引导DOS或其他操作系统。BIOS先从软盘或硬盘的开始扇区读取引导记录,然后把计算机的控制权转交给引导记录,由引导记录把操作系统装入计算机,在计算机启动成功后,BIOS的这部分任务就完成了。2.硬件中断处理BIOS的服务功能是通过调用中断服务程序来实现的,这些服务分为很多组,每组有一个专门的中断。3.程序服务处理程序服务处理主要是为应用程序和操作系统服务,这些服务主要与输入/输出设备有关,例如,读磁盘、文件输出到打印机等。江西工业工程职业技术学院丁强华2019年7月30日星期二10时44分45秒11第二节BIOS系统3.2.3BIOS的种类1.AwardBIOS(美国惟尔科技)AwardBIOS(图3-6)是由AwardSoftware公司开发的BIOS产品。目前它是生产BIOS的龙头,许多公司的主板都采用AwardBIOS。AwardBIOS几乎成为IntelCPU系列主板的标准规格。3.PhoenixBIOS(美国凤凰科技)PhoenixBIOS(图3-8)是Phoenix公司的产品,多用于高档的国外品牌机和笔记本计算机上,其画面简洁、便于操作(目前Phoenix与Award已经合并)。2.AMIBIOS(美国安迈公司)AMIBIOS(图3-7)是AMI公司生产的BIOS,早期的286、386大多采用AMIBIOS。后来推出的WinBIOS和HIFLEX等系列产品也赢得了不错的口碑。但586以后就很少见了。江西工业工程职业技术学院丁强华2019年7月30日星期二10时44分45秒12第二节BIOS系统3.2.4BIOS芯片的种类常见的BIOS芯片种类有:1.PROMPROM可编程ROM。可用专门的ROM设备写入内容,只允许写一次。EPROM可擦除可编程ROM。利用专门的EPROM写入器写入内容。可以多次改写,更新程序比较方便。因此在早期的PC机中都使用EPROM作为BIOS程序的存储器。它有一个透明的小窗口(如图3-18),平时用黑纸封闭。只有在对其BIOS程序进行改写、修复或升级时,才揭开黑纸。用紫外线照射窗门内的硅晶片,擦除存储数据,再重新输入新的程序。EPROM的型号是以27开头的,如27C020(8×256K)是一片2MBits容量的EPROM芯片。2.EPROM江西工业工程职业技术学院丁强华2019年7月30日星期二10时44分45秒13第二节BIOS系统3.EEPROMEEPROM电可擦除可编程ROM。目前的主板都使用EEPROM保存BIOS。EEPROM存储器也叫做闪速存储器FlashROM,简称闪存BIOS,如图3-11所示。闪存的特点是程序改写、升级方便,只需在机器运行的正常情况下使用专门的应用程序,将来自厂家或网上的最新版本的BIOS写人闪存即可。FlashROM大致可分为两种:一种是双电压设计的如28xxxx,5V电压读取,12V电压写入,重写时需改跳线。另一种是单电压设计的如29xxxx,5V电压即可读写,所以不一定有改写跳线,但为安全起见,一般也设有改写跳线。“010”或“001”表明芯片的存储容量为1Mbit(128KB),“020”或“002”,表明芯片的存储容量为2Mbit(256KB)。如Am29F010:AMD5V的FlashROM,为29系列,1Mbit,读写均为5V。显然,EEPROM的BIOS也有致命的弱点,它很容易被CIH类的病毒改写破坏,致使主板瘫痪。为此,有些厂家在主板上采取了硬件跳线禁止写入闪存BIOS、软件COMS设置禁止写入闪存BIOS和双BIOS闪存芯片等保护性措施。江西工业工程职业技术学院丁强华2019年7月30日星期二10时44分45秒14第二节BIOS系统3.2.5双BIOS技术双BIOS是在主板上安装两个BIOS,一块芯片为正常工作时使用的BIOS,另—个为备份的BIOS。当由于病毒或其他原因使正常工作的BIOS损坏时,可通一个开关切换到备份的BIOS上,使用备份的BIOS。也可以用一个好的BIOS芯片把备份BIOS的程序写到的主BIOS上。技嘉GA-BX2000首创了双BIOS技术,即使一颗BIOS被破坏,仍可用另一颗BIOS启动并修复被破坏的那颗BIOS。使用户不再害怕CIH的攻击。六、无敌锁技术联想的无敌锁技术也是为了防止CIH病毒而设计的。它由三部分组成:它们分别是主板上的防写保护跳线开关JAV,内置于BIOS中的软开关FlashWriteProtect和内置于BIOS中的防毒软件PCCillin。Intel主板具有一个特殊的功能,当BIOS程序被毁坏时可以用它来使主板“起死回生”,这个功能就是“BIOSRecovery”。当Intel主板上的FlashBIOS被病毒感染了,可以应用这个功能来清除BIOS中的病毒,并恢复BIOS的原始状态。实际上,整个无敌锁技术是从几个方位对可攻击BIOS的病毒进行防卫,保护BIOS不被破坏,这是一个整体防护体系,可最大限度的保护BIOS。江西工业工程职业技术学院丁强华2019年7月30日星期二10时44分45秒15第二节BIOS系统七、BIOS在内存中的位置BIOS存储于ROM中。开机时,BIOS程序会将自身复制到RAM中编址为C0000H-FFFFFH地址空间内,这一过程称作“映射”(Showing),此技术叫“ShadowRAM”技术。访问ROM的时间在200ns左右,而访问RAM的时间小于100ns。在系统运行的过程中,读取BIOS中的数据或调用BIOS中的程序模块是相当频繁的,所以采用了ShadowRAM技术后,会大大提高了工作效率。八、常见进入BIOS设置的方法开机时单击选定的热键可以进入BIOS设置程序,不同类型的机器进入BIOS设置程序的按键不同,有的在屏幕上给出提示,有的不给提示,几种常见的BIOS进

1 / 55
下载文档,编辑使用

©2015-2020 m.777doc.com 三七文档.

备案号:鲁ICP备2024069028号-1 客服联系 QQ:2149211541

×
保存成功